Over the centuries, immigrants and natives have enriched British culture bringing with them different ways of living. But, first we need to understand where the people came from and its settlement ir order to contextualized the process of UK shaping the world.
The outline of Britain's political, economic and cultural history from Neolithic times until now is full of important facts describing how these groups of people were developing certain customs, art, skills and so on. The history of Prehistoric England, from Stonehenge represent some evidence about the first inhabitants and the notion of what was the stone circle built for.
The earliest people are thought to have come to Britain about 500,000 years ago. During the ages, many tribes like the Celts and Belgae developed knowledge of tools, languages and a wide mix of cultures and also became the dominant people in the country.
In human terms, the UK has an extraordinarily rich and diverse heritage becoming a powerful nation with one language and culture. In my opinion, the richness of UK cultural life is because of its history. For many years different people and cultures have had an influence on the UK and consequently played a role in creating the society they live today.
